The Top 5 Things to Consider When Doing A modern Renovation
  • Layout: Consider the size and layout of the bathroom when planning the remodel. Ensure that the fixtures are placed in a way that maximizes the available space.
  • Style: Choose a modern style that complements the overall design of the home. Look for sleek fixtures, minimalist designs and neutral colors to achieve a contemporary look.
  • Lighting: Adequate lighting is essential in a modern bathroom. Consider installing energy-efficient LED lights that provide bright and even illumination throughout the space.
  • Storage: Think about the amount of storage needed for toiletries, towels and other bathroom essentials. Opt for space-saving solutions like floating shelves, wall-mounted cabinets or under-sink drawers.
  • Technology: Incorporate modern technologies such as smart faucets, touchless flush toilets or Bluetooth-enabled speakers for an added touch of luxury and convenience.

Doing a Remodel in Little Italy
Little Italy, located in Lower Manhattan, is a historic neighborhood known for its rich culture, delicious food, and charming atmosphere. If you're planning a remodel in Little Italy, it's essential to preserve the area's unique character and heritage. One of the most popular renovation projects in Little Italy is updating a classic brownstone or tenement building. This type of remodel requires careful attention to detail, ensuring that the building maintains its historic charm and aesthetic. It's also essential to work with local contractors and architects who understand the neighborhood's zoning and building codes. Other popular renovation projects in Little Italy include transforming old storefronts into modern retail spaces or updating traditional townhouses for modern living. Whatever your renovation project, be sure to respect the neighborhood's history and culture to preserve its unique charm.
